1. The Problem — The Uncanny Valley of Syntax

AI-generated text suffers from Linguistic Entropy. It prioritizes the "most likely next token," which results in a frictionless, polite, and ultimately invisible voice. When every sentence is "pivotal" and "seamless," nothing is.

The humanizer task is not about adding slang. It is about restoring the resistance of a thinking mind. Traditional humanizer prompts are low-density lists of "don't say X." Seeds are generative heuristics that force the model to simulate the messy process of having an opinion.


2. Seed Schema — Structural Integrity Check

Every LinguaSeed must pass four invariants to ensure it generates soul rather than just synonyms.

Invariant Requirement
Compression Under 12 words. High-density heuristic — no room for qualifiers.
Generative Must force a rewrite of structure, not just word choice.
Falsifiable If ignored, the text remains AI-smooth. The failure is visible.
Decompressible Must imply the specific AI-isms to be purged — no ambiguity about what to cut.

3. Seed Registry — v1.0

The registry is append-only. Seeds are never deleted — only superseded.

Seed Pattern Deploy When
"Only gravity proves weight" Gravity — Replace vague importance with concrete data. Weight must be demonstrated, not declared. Words like "pivotal," "testament," or "underscores" appear.
"Vary the stride to prove the walker" Stride — Break the monotonous rhythm of medium-length sentences. Humans don't pace evenly. Text reads like a predictable metronome or a Wikipedia entry.
"Doubt is the signature of a mind" Doubt — Acknowledge complexity, uncertainty, and mixed feelings. Certainty is the AI tell. Output is overly confident, sycophantic, or purely neutral.
"Concrete breaks the glass of abstraction" Concrete — Swap marketing fluff for specific, functional mechanics. Name the thing. Words like "vibrant," "seamless," or "unleash" are present.
"Remove the grease to find the grip" Grip — Eliminate participles (-ing constructions) and elegant variations. Friction over flow. Sentences feel slippery — "the application" instead of "the app."
"A shadow has no teeth" Teeth — Eliminate hedging and weasel words. Claim the position or don't make it. Text uses "experts believe," "it might," or "potentially."
"The second pass burns the dross" Dross — Recursive critique: identify the AI "tell" before fixing it. Name it, then cut it. Final polishing pass to remove chatbot artifacts and sycophancy.
"Scars prove the skin was there" Scars — Inject first-person perspective and subjective asides. Evidence of a body behind the words. Writing feels clean but soulless — technically correct, humanly absent.

4. Deployment — How to Plant a Seed

In LLM System Prompts

Instead of a list of 200 forbidden words, inject the Seed Block.

Operate under the Gravity Seed and the Stride Seed.
If a sentence feels seamless, break it.

This forces the model to rethink its internal probability map before a single token is generated — an identity constraint, not a style rule.

In Content Editing

Use seeds as a diagnostic lens. If a paragraph feels off, ask: "Which seed is missing?"

  • Missing Gravity? Add a hard fact.
  • Missing Stride? Cut a sentence in half. Use a fragment.
  • Missing Doubt? Acknowledge the counterargument.

The Anti-AI Recursive Pass — Dross Seed

  1. Prompt: "Stare at this text. What makes it obviously AI?"
  2. Action: The model identifies its own tells — "I used the word 'landscape' three times."
  3. Prompt: "Now apply the Grip Seed and excise them."

This recursive loop forces the model into self-adversarial editing — the closest approximation to a human writer's internal critic.
